Geico is an insurance company focusing on auto, homeowners, renters, and various policies. Founded in 1936, the company has grown to become a prominent provider in the industry under the leadership of CEO Todd Combs. Geico's diverse range of products includes coverage for autos, homeowners, renters, condos, boats, and RVs, catering to a wide variety of customer needs.

Acquired by Berkshire Hathaway in 1996, Geico's commitment to affordable insurance solutions is supported by the ease of use offered through their mobile application. Users can make payments, report claims, and chat with insurance agents all within the app. Geico is headquartered in Maryland and employs a diverse workforce of 40,000 professionals who contribute to an impressive annual revenue of $25.5 billion. With this diversity and revenue, Geico continues to thrive as an industry leader.

GEICO's Mission Statement

GEICO's seven operating principles help create a workplace in which their associates can thrive. 1. Respect, support and provide opportunity for all associates. 2. Be fanatics for outstanding customer service. 3. Be the low-cost provider. 4. Operate with uncompromising integrity. 5. Maintain a disciplined balance sheet. 6. Make an underwriting profit while achieving optimum growth. 7. Invest for total return.

The average a GEICO salary in the United States is $44,417 per year. GEICO employees in the top 10 percent can make over $74,000 per year, while GEICO employees at the bottom 10 percent earn less than $26,000 per year.

Compare GEICO salaries to competitors, including Esurance, The Travelers Companies, and USAA. Employees at Esurance earn the highest average yearly salary of $66,733. The salaries at The Travelers Companies average $66,351 per year, and the salaries at USAA come in at $59,089 per year.
